Runways

Runways: 07/25

Runway 07/25

Length: 3810 feet
Width: 30 feet
Surface: Natural Soil, Good Condition
First 270 Ft of Runway from Threshold Can be Muddy with Standing Water After Rain.
End 07 End 25
Objects: Bldg
Runway 07 +18 Ft Bldg, 255 Ft from Runway End, 60Ft Left, Obstruction Slope 18:1
 
Objects affecting Navigable Airspace (CFR part 77): Utility runway with a visual approach Utility runway with a visual approach
Object Clearance Slope: 12:1 50:1
Object Height: 15' AGL  
Object Distance: 190' Along centerline
120' Right of centerline
 
Other Objects: Runway 07 +15 Ft Bldg, 102 Ft from Runway End, 60 Ft Left, Clearance 6:1.  

Procedures

Additional Remarks

Abndd Apt 1.5 Mi W.
Antelope on & in View of Airport.
Runway 07/25 Has +2 to 4 Ft Berms 40 Ft Either Side of Centerline.
Old Style Runway Cones/Lights Mark Runways 40' Either Side of Crtln - Runways 07/25.
Line of Sight Problem Between Runway 07 & 25 Threshold; Runway 25 Slopes Uphill First 510'.
